word表格怎么导入excel表格中

word表格怎么导入excel表格中

将Word表格导入Excel表格中有多种方法使用复制粘贴、利用Excel的导入功能、通过VBA宏编程。最常用且简单的方法是直接复制粘贴,因为这种方法最直观且适用大多数场景。以下详细描述如何通过复制粘贴的方法导入Word表格到Excel中。

使用复制粘贴方法:打开Word文档,选择表格,复制表格内容,打开Excel文件,在目标单元格粘贴内容。复制粘贴法能够保持数据的格式和布局,是大部分用户的首选。下面详细描述具体步骤和注意事项。


一、使用复制粘贴方法

1.1 选择与复制Word表格

打开包含表格的Word文档,使用鼠标选择整个表格。可以点击表格左上角的四向箭头图标来快速选择整个表格。按下 Ctrl+C 组合键复制表格内容。

1.2 打开并粘贴到Excel

打开目标Excel文件,选择你希望粘贴表格的单元格区域。按下 Ctrl+V 组合键将表格内容粘贴到Excel中。粘贴后,检查表格内容是否完整,格式是否正确。如果有需要,可以调整单元格宽度和高度。

1.3 保持格式一致性

在某些情况下,粘贴表格后可能需要调整格式以保持一致性。可以使用Excel的 “格式刷” 工具来复制格式,或者手动调整字体、边框和对齐方式。


二、使用Excel的导入功能

2.1 将Word表格保存为文本文件

另一个方法是将Word表格转换为文本文件,然后在Excel中导入。首先,打开Word文档,选择表格,复制内容。打开记事本(Notepad),将复制的内容粘贴进去,然后保存为文本文件(.txt格式)。

2.2 导入文本文件到Excel

在Excel中,点击 “数据” 选项卡,然后选择 “从文本/CSV”。找到刚才保存的文本文件,点击 “导入”。在导入向导中,选择适当的分隔符(例如,制表符或逗号)以正确分隔数据。

2.3 调整数据格式

导入后,可能需要调整数据的格式和布局。可以使用Excel的 “文本分列” 功能进一步细化数据的分割和排列。


三、使用VBA宏编程

3.1 创建VBA宏

对于更复杂的需求,可以编写VBA宏来自动化导入过程。打开Excel,按下 Alt+F11 打开VBA编辑器,选择 “插入” 菜单,然后选择 “模块” 来创建新的模块。

3.2 编写导入代码

在模块中编写VBA代码来读取Word文档并导入表格内容。例如,可以使用以下代码模板:

Sub ImportWordTable()

Dim wdApp As Object

Dim wdDoc As Object

Dim wdTable As Object

Dim ws As Worksheet

Dim i As Integer, j As Integer

' 创建Word应用程序对象

Set wdApp = CreateObject("Word.Application")

' 打开Word文档

Set wdDoc = wdApp.Documents.Open("C:PathToYourDocument.docx")

' 获取第一个表格

Set wdTable = wdDoc.Tables(1)

' 设置目标工作表

Set ws = ThisWorkbook.Sheets("Sheet1")

' 遍历表格并复制到Excel

For i = 1 To wdTable.Rows.Count

For j = 1 To wdTable.Columns.Count

ws.Cells(i, j).Value = wdTable.Cell(i, j).Range.Text

Next j

Next i

' 关闭Word文档

wdDoc.Close False

wdApp.Quit

' 释放对象

Set wdTable = Nothing

Set wdDoc = Nothing

Set wdApp = Nothing

End Sub

3.3 运行VBA宏

关闭VBA编辑器,回到Excel,按下 Alt+F8 打开宏对话框,选择刚刚创建的宏并点击 “运行”。VBA宏将自动执行导入过程并将表格内容填充到Excel中。


四、注意事项与小技巧

4.1 保持数据一致性

无论使用哪种方法,保持数据的一致性是关键。在导入前,确保Word表格的结构和格式清晰,避免合并单元格和复杂的嵌套结构。

4.2 处理特殊字符

在导入过程中,特殊字符可能会影响数据的显示和处理。可以使用Excel的查找和替换功能,或者在导入前在Word中进行预处理。

4.3 自动化处理

对于频繁需要导入的表格,可以考虑使用VBA宏或Excel的Power Query功能来自动化处理,节省时间和精力。

4.4 数据验证

导入后,使用Excel的数据验证功能确保数据的准确性和完整性。可以设置数据验证规则,以避免错误输入和不一致的数据。


五、总结

将Word表格导入Excel表格中是一项常见的任务,通过掌握多种方法,可以根据具体需求选择最合适的方式。复制粘贴方法最为简单直观,适用于大多数场景。利用Excel的导入功能可以处理更复杂的数据结构,而VBA宏编程则提供了高度的自动化和灵活性。通过合理选择和应用这些方法,可以有效地提高工作效率,确保数据的准确性和一致性。

相关问答FAQs:

1. 如何将Word表格导入Excel表格中?

  • 问题: 我想将一个Word文档中的表格导入到Excel中,应该如何操作?
  • 回答: 你可以使用以下步骤将Word表格导入到Excel中:
    • 打开Word文档并选中要导入的表格。
    • 使用复制(Ctrl+C)或剪切(Ctrl+X)命令将表格复制到剪贴板。
    • 打开Excel文档,定位到你想要插入表格的位置。
    • 使用粘贴(Ctrl+V)命令将表格从剪贴板粘贴到Excel中。
    • 根据需要进行任何其他编辑或格式调整。

2. 怎样将Word中的表格转移到Excel中?

  • 问题: 我有一个Word文档中的表格,想要将它们转移到Excel中,有什么方法吗?
  • 回答: 你可以使用以下步骤将Word中的表格转移到Excel中:
    • 打开Word文档并选中要转移的表格。
    • 右击表格并选择“复制”选项。
    • 打开Excel文档,定位到你想要插入表格的位置。
    • 右击目标位置并选择“粘贴”选项。
    • 根据需要进行任何其他编辑或格式调整。

3. 如何将Word文档中的表格导入到Excel表格中?

  • 问题: 我有一个Word文档中的表格,想要将它们导入到Excel表格中,有什么方法吗?
  • 回答: 你可以按照以下步骤将Word文档中的表格导入到Excel表格中:
    • 打开Word文档并选中要导入的表格。
    • 使用复制(Ctrl+C)或剪切(Ctrl+X)命令将表格复制到剪贴板。
    • 打开Excel文档,定位到你想要插入表格的位置。
    • 使用粘贴(Ctrl+V)命令将表格从剪贴板粘贴到Excel中。
    • 根据需要进行任何其他编辑或格式调整。

文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4404653

(0)
Edit1Edit1
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部